Everton winning the race to sign Premier League winger
Everton are understood to be leading the likes of Arsenal and Tottenham Hotspur in the race to sign Ryan Fraser on a free transfer.
The Scotland international has recently refused to extend his deal beyond June 30 and he is expected to become a free-agent at the end of the month.
Gunners and Spurs have been mentioned as the leading candidates to sign the forward in recent weeks but The Mail claims that the Toffees are leading the queue.
Toffees boss Carlo Ancelotti is said to be determined to bring Fraser to Goodison Park and reports claim that Fraser has told his Cherries teammates that he will make the switch to Merseyside next month.
Fraser has struggled for form during the course of the current Premier League campaign and he has bagged just one goal and four assists from 28 appearances.
Still, he has remained highly valued by a number of Premier League sides and it appears that the Toffees are now the front-runners to sign him on a Bosman transfer.
